Output 63037c744b8a1e10f650acdd4f88575ab6d6cd133fd55f3507a782826578f877:1

value
14645350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 821055de793c111ac2b5ec46edbdfe83e68556a4 OP_EQUAL
address
3DYjLVCXA4UbiiVroVMZz2HxRmDKbSkLgT
transaction
63037c744b8a1e10f650acdd4f88575ab6d6cd133fd55f3507a782826578f877
confirmations
397607
spent
true